    Boosting Digestion and Soothing Tummies: The Digestive Powerhouse

    One of the most celebrated benefits of mint leaf water is its positive impact on digestion. For centuries, mint has been used to alleviate digestive issues, and for a good reason! Mint contains compounds, particularly menthol, that can help relax the muscles in your digestive tract. This relaxation can reduce bloating, gas, and indigestion, making your tummy feel much happier. If you're someone who often experiences digestive discomfort after meals, mint leaf water could be a game-changer. Imagine enjoying your favorite meals without the usual post-meal bloat and discomfort. Sounds amazing, right? Moreover, mint can stimulate the production of digestive enzymes, which help break down food more efficiently. This means your body can absorb nutrients better, leading to improved overall health and energy levels. It's like giving your digestive system a little pep talk, encouraging it to work at its best. Beyond its direct impact on digestion, mint also has anti-inflammatory properties. Inflammation in the gut can contribute to various digestive problems. By reducing inflammation, mint leaf water can provide additional relief and promote a healthier gut environment. So, whether you're dealing with occasional indigestion or more chronic digestive issues, a glass of mint leaf water can offer soothing relief and support your digestive health.     Making Mint Leaf Water: Easy Recipes and Tips

    Ready to jump on the mint leaf water bandwagon? Making it is incredibly easy. Here’s a basic recipe to get you started, along with some tips to elevate your minty experience.

    Basic Recipe:

    1. Gather Your Ingredients: You’ll need fresh mint leaves and water (filtered water is ideal).
    2. Rinse the Mint: Gently rinse a handful of mint leaves to remove any dirt or debris.
    3. Muddle (Optional): Lightly muddle the mint leaves in a glass or pitcher to release their flavors. This step is optional but can intensify the minty taste.
    4. Add Water: Pour water over the mint leaves. For a refreshing taste, use cold water or add ice cubes.
    5. Steep: Let the mint leaves steep for at least 15-30 minutes, or longer for a more potent flavor. The longer you steep, the stronger the mint taste will be.
    6. Strain (Optional): If you prefer, strain the leaves before drinking.

    Tips and Variations:

    • Experiment with Mint Varieties: Different types of mint, such as peppermint or spearmint, can offer slightly different flavor profiles.
    • Add Other Herbs: Try adding other herbs like cucumber slices, lemon wedges, or ginger for a more complex flavor profile.
    • Sweeten Naturally (Optional): If you prefer a touch of sweetness, add a small amount of honey or stevia. Avoid refined sugars.
    • Make a Big Batch: Prepare a large pitcher of mint leaf water to keep in your refrigerator for easy access throughout the day.

    Potential Side Effects and Considerations

    While mint leaf water is generally safe for most people, it's always a good idea to be aware of potential side effects and considerations. Here’s what you should keep in mind:

    • Allergies: Although rare, some people may be allergic to mint. If you experience any allergic reactions (itching, rash, swelling), stop drinking mint leaf water and consult a healthcare professional.
    • Heartburn: In some individuals, mint can relax the esophageal sphincter, which can potentially worsen heartburn symptoms. If you have a history of heartburn, monitor your symptoms and reduce or avoid mint leaf water if necessary.
    • Medication Interactions: Mint may interact with certain medications. If you’re taking any medications, especially those for heartburn or blood sugar, consult with your doctor before consuming mint leaf water regularly.
    • Dosage: While there’s no specific recommended daily intake, consuming excessive amounts of mint might lead to digestive upset in some individuals. Start with a moderate amount and adjust based on how your body responds.

    It’s always a good practice to listen to your body and adjust your intake accordingly. If you have any underlying health conditions or concerns, it's advisable to speak with a healthcare professional before making any significant dietary changes. Overall, mint leaf water is a safe and beneficial drink for most people when consumed in moderation.
